A duel suspension bike, also known as a full suspension bike, is a bike that has
shock absorbers / shock forks on both the front and the back of the bike frame.
These types of shocks are commonly put on mountain bikes that need to go over a
wide variety of terrain, as they make the ride more comfortable for someone who is riding over
bumps, rocks, and tree stumps.
